Python是一种高级、解释型、通用的编程语言,具有以下特点:
易学性:
Python语法简洁明了,易于学习和理解。
高可读性:
代码遵循明确的缩进规则,结构清晰,便于阅读和维护。
易维护性:
简洁的语法和清晰的结构使得代码易于维护。
丰富的标准库:
提供了大量模块和函数,覆盖多个领域,如网络编程、数据处理、图形界面等。
跨平台性:
Python代码可以在多种操作系统上运行,如Windows、Linux、macOS等。
动态类型:
变量类型在运行时确定,支持灵活的数据类型处理。
解释执行:
Python代码无需编译成二进制代码,由解释器逐行执行。
开源:
Python是开源的,用户可以自由地使用、修改和分发源代码。
可扩展性:
支持与其他语言(如C、C++、Java)交互和集成,可以使用C或C++编写性能要求高的部分,然后在Python中调用。
多范式支持:
支持面向对象、函数式、过程式等多种编程范式。
丰富的第三方库:
拥有成千上万的第三方库和框架,如Django(Web框架)、NumPy(数学和科学计算)、Pandas(数据分析)等。
Python因其简单易学、功能强大、应用广泛等特点,在编程社区中非常受欢迎,并且被广泛用于Web开发、数据科学、人工智能、自动化脚本编写等领域